Skip to content
体验新版
项目
组织
正在加载...
登录
切换导航
打开侧边栏
JimmyNoah
handpose_x
提交
66204355
handpose_x
项目概览
JimmyNoah
/
handpose_x
与 Fork 源项目一致
Fork自
DataBall / handpose_x
通知
1
Star
0
Fork
0
代码
文件
提交
分支
Tags
贡献者
分支图
Diff
Issue
0
列表
看板
标记
里程碑
合并请求
0
DevOps
流水线
流水线任务
计划
Wiki
0
Wiki
分析
仓库
DevOps
项目成员
Pages
handpose_x
项目概览
项目概览
详情
发布
仓库
仓库
文件
提交
分支
标签
贡献者
分支图
比较
Issue
0
Issue
0
列表
看板
标记
里程碑
合并请求
0
合并请求
0
Pages
DevOps
DevOps
流水线
流水线任务
计划
分析
分析
仓库分析
DevOps
Wiki
0
Wiki
成员
成员
收起侧边栏
关闭侧边栏
动态
分支图
创建新Issue
流水线任务
提交
Issue看板
体验新版 GitCode,发现更多精彩内容 >>
提交
66204355
编写于
2月 26, 2021
作者:
DataBall
🚴🏻
浏览文件
操作
浏览文件
下载
电子邮件补丁
差异文件
update readme
上级
b2eb3a81
变更
1
隐藏空白更改
内联
并排
Showing
1 changed file
with
9 addition
and
9 deletion
+9
-9
README.md
README.md
+9
-9
未找到文件。
README.md
浏览文件 @
66204355
...
...
@@ -5,16 +5,16 @@
注意:该项目不包括手部检测部分,手部检测项目地址:https://codechina.csdn.net/EricLee/yolo_v3
该项目是对手的21个关键点进行检测,示例如下 :
*
图片示例:
![
image
](
https://codechina.csdn.net/
weixin_42140236
/handpose_x/-/raw/master/samples/test.png
)
![
image
](
https://codechina.csdn.net/
EricLee
/handpose_x/-/raw/master/samples/test.png
)
*
视频示例:
![
video
](
https://codechina.csdn.net/
weixin_42140236
/handpose_x/-/raw/master/samples/sample.gif
)
![
video
](
https://codechina.csdn.net/
EricLee
/handpose_x/-/raw/master/samples/sample.gif
)
## Demo小样
*
示例1 - 按键操作
因为考虑到目前没有三维姿态不好识别按键按下三维动作,所以目前采用二维方式。
该示例的原理:通过简单的IOU跟踪,对二维目标如手的边界框或是特定手指的较长时间位置稳定性判断确定触发按键动作的时刻,用特定指尖的二维坐标确定触发位置。
(注意:目前示例并未添加到工程,后期整理后会进行发布,只是一个样例,同时希望同学们自己尝试写自己基于该项目的小应用。)
![
keyboard
](
https://codechina.csdn.net/
weixin_42140236
/handpose_x/-/raw/master/samples/keyboard.gif
)
![
keyboard
](
https://codechina.csdn.net/
EricLee
/handpose_x/-/raw/master/samples/keyboard.gif
)
*
示例2 - 手势交互:指定区域物体识别
该示例的出发点是希望通过手势指定用户想要识别的物体。那么就要选中物体的准确边界框才能达到理想识别效果。如果待识别目标边界框太大会引入背景干扰,太小又会时目标特征不完全。所以希望通过手势指定较准确的目标边界框。因为边界框涉及左上、右下两个二维坐标,所以通过两只手的特定指尖来确定。且触发逻辑与示例1相同。
...
...
@@ -22,11 +22,11 @@
(注意:目前示例并未添加到工程,后期整理后会进行发布,只是一个样例,同时希望同学们自己尝试写自己基于该项目的小应用。)
该示例依赖于另外一个物体识别分类项目。
![
keyboard
](
https://codechina.csdn.net/
weixin_42140236
/handpose_x/-/raw/master/samples/recognize_obj0.gif
)
![
keyboard
](
https://codechina.csdn.net/
EricLee
/handpose_x/-/raw/master/samples/recognize_obj0.gif
)
*
以下是对书上狗的图片进行分类识别的样例,同学们可以根据自己对应的物体识别分类需求替换对应的分类识别模型即可。
![
recoobj_book
](
https://codechina.csdn.net/
weixin_42140236
/handpose_x/-/raw/master/samples/recobj_book.gif
)
![
recoobj_book
](
https://codechina.csdn.net/
EricLee
/handpose_x/-/raw/master/samples/recobj_book.gif
)
该物体识别分类项目的地址为: https://codechina.csdn.net/EricLee/classification
...
...
@@ -36,10 +36,10 @@
目前该示例由于静态手势数据集的限制,目前用手骨骼的二维角度约束定义静态手势,原理如下图,计算向量AC和DE的角度,它们之间的角度大于某一个角度阈值(经验值)定义为弯曲,小于摸一个阈值(经验值)为伸直。
注:这种静态手势识别的方法具有局限性,有条件还是通过模型训练的方法进行静态手势识别。
![
gs
](
https://codechina.csdn.net/
weixin_42140236
/handpose_x/-/raw/master/samples/gest.jpg
)
![
gs
](
https://codechina.csdn.net/
EricLee
/handpose_x/-/raw/master/samples/gest.jpg
)
视频示例如下图:
![
gesture
](
https://codechina.csdn.net/
weixin_42140236
/handpose_x/-/raw/master/samples/gesture.gif
)
![
gesture
](
https://codechina.csdn.net/
EricLee
/handpose_x/-/raw/master/samples/gesture.gif
)
*
示例4 - 静态手势交互(识别)
通过手关键点的二维角度约束关系定义静态手势。
...
...
@@ -48,7 +48,7 @@
原理:通过二维约束获得静态手势,该示例是通过 食指伸直(one) 和 握拳(fist)分别代表范围选择和清空选择区域。
建议最好还是通过分类模型做静态手势识别鲁棒和准确高,目前局限于静态手势训练集的问题用二维约束关系定义静态手势替代。
![
ocrreco
](
https://codechina.csdn.net/
weixin_42140236
/handpose_x/-/raw/master/samples/ocrreco.gif
)
![
ocrreco
](
https://codechina.csdn.net/
EricLee
/handpose_x/-/raw/master/samples/ocrreco.gif
)
## 项目配置
...
...
@@ -63,7 +63,7 @@
感谢《Large-scale Multiview 3D Hand Pose Dataset》数据集贡献者:Francisco Gomez-Donoso, Sergio Orts-Escolano, and Miguel Cazorla. "Large-scale Multiview 3D Hand Pose Dataset". ArXiv e-prints 1707.03742, July 2017.
*
标注文件示例:
![
label
](
https://codechina.csdn.net/
weixin_42140236
/handpose_x/-/raw/master/samples/label.png
)
![
label
](
https://codechina.csdn.net/
EricLee
/handpose_x/-/raw/master/samples/label.png
)
*
[
该项目用到的制作数据集下载地址(百度网盘 Password: ara8 )
](
https://pan.baidu.com/s/1KY7lAFXBTfrFHlApxTY8NA
)
...
...
编辑
预览
Markdown
is supported
0%
请重试
或
添加新附件
.
添加附件
取消
You are about to add
0
people
to the discussion. Proceed with caution.
先完成此消息的编辑!
取消
想要评论请
注册
或
登录